Olympus Property has purchased Aiya, a 360-unit multifamily community in Gilbert, Ariz., for $112 million or $311,111 per unitThe Wolff Co. was the property’s seller. The property is near the intersection of US 60 and the San Tan Freeway.

Institutional Property Advisors brokered the transaction, with Steve Gebing and Cliff David working on behalf of the seller and procuring the buyer. The acquisition financing was arranged by a IPA Capital Markets team led by Brian Eisendrath.

Completed in 2022, the garden-style community encompasses 16 buildings with one-, two- and three-bedroom floorplans ranging between 546 square feet and 1,228 square feet.
